Company Overview
History and Background
NewJersey Resources Corporation (NJR) was founded in 1952 as New Jersey Natural Gas Company. It has evolved from a single-utility operation to a diversified energy company with operations throughout New Jersey and beyond.
Core Business Areas
- New Jersey Natural Gas: Distribution of natural gas to customers in central and northern New Jersey.
- NJR Energy Services: Wholesale energy marketing and trading.
- NJR Clean Energy Ventures: Investment in and operation of clean energy projects, including solar and wind.
- NJR Storage and Transportation: Provides natural gas storage and transportation services.
Leadership and Structure
The leadership team is headed by the CEO, Steve Westhoven. The organizational structure includes various departments overseeing finance, operations, marketing, and strategy, ensuring efficient management and strategic direction.
Top Products and Market Share
Key Offerings
- Natural Gas Distribution: Delivery of natural gas to over 578,000 residential and business customers. Market share in its service territory is close to 100% but it's difficult to expand past this because it is an area with regulated monopolies. Competitors are other forms of energy such as electricity and oil.
- Wholesale Energy: Energy Services engages in energy marketing and trading activities. Market share varies, operating in a competitive wholesale market where players like BP and Shell Energy North America are significant competitors. Hard to pinpoint exact market share.
- Clean Energy Investments: Investments in solar and wind projects. Operates in a growing but competitive market, with national and international players like NextEra Energy Resources and Invenergy. Market share is based on installed capacity which is hard to pin down given how small NJR is relative to these competitors.

Major Acquisitions
Leaf River Energy Center
- Year: 2020
- Acquisition Price (USD millions): 367.5
- Strategic Rationale: Expanded NJR's natural gas storage capabilities.

New Jersey Resources Corporation, an energy services holding company, distributes natural gas. The company operates through four segments: Natural Gas Distribution, Clean Energy Ventures, Energy Services, and Storage and Transportation. The Natural Gas Distribution segment offers regulated natural gas utility services to residential and commercial customers in Burlington, Middlesex, Monmouth, Morris, Ocean, and Sussex counties in New Jersey; provides capacity and storage management services; and participates in the off-system sales and capacity release markets. The Clean Energy Ventures segment invests in, owns, and operates clean energy projects, including commercial and residential solar installation situated in New Jersey, Rhode Island, New York, Connecticut, Michigan, and Indiana. The Energy Services segment maintains and operates natural gas transportation and storage capacity contracts, as well as provides physical wholesale energy, retail energy and energy management services. The Storage and Transportation segment invests in energy-related ventures. It provides heating, ventilation, and cooling services; sales and installation of appliances; solar equipment installation, and plumbing repair and installation services, as well as holds commercial real estate properties. The company was founded in 1922 and is headquartered in Wall, New Jersey.
